Output 6e6318d6744279827ce2ef77fee1bb93ae34f7edbbdd72e2c02a7205c9c9ebd6:1

value
4578749
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04234ebcbfaff407fcba1930a1445d71abc133de OP_EQUAL
address
324tvXLae5Jvfu326UVQL7R2snD9txvHm5
transaction
6e6318d6744279827ce2ef77fee1bb93ae34f7edbbdd72e2c02a7205c9c9ebd6
confirmations
431227
spent
true